A suspect is finally in custody after investigators find Eulalio Tordil, who is suspected to be responsible for a 2 day shooting spree in Maryland. The spree began with a homicide in a high school parking lot Thursday, and ending at two Maryland shopping centers; these shootings killed two people and injured two others. Tordil was charged with first degree murder and will appear in court soon.
